激情久久久_欧美视频区_成人av免费_不卡视频一二三区_欧美精品在欧美一区二区少妇_欧美一区二区三区的

服務器之家:專注于服務器技術及軟件下載分享
分類導航

Linux|Centos|Ubuntu|系統進程|Fedora|注冊表|Bios|Solaris|Windows7|Windows10|Windows11|windows server|

服務器之家 - 服務器系統 - Linux - Linux輸入輸出重定向詳細使用說明

Linux輸入輸出重定向詳細使用說明

2022-03-03 17:08Linux教程網 Linux

Linux標準輸入、輸出設備主要是鍵盤和顯示器,輸出重定向是改變程序運行的輸入來源和輸出地點

1、Linux標準輸入輸出
Linux標準輸入、輸出設備主要是鍵盤和顯示器,詳細介紹如下表所示。

 

Linux標準輸入輸出
設備 設備文件名 文件描述符 類型 符號表示
鍵盤 /dev/stdin 0(缺省是鍵盤,為0時是文件或者其他命令的輸出) 標準輸入 < <<
顯示器 /dev/stdout 1(缺省是屏幕,為1時是文件) 標準輸出 > >>
顯示器 /dev/stderr 2(缺省是屏幕,為2時是文件) 標準錯誤輸出 2> 2>>

 

注:其中一個>表示:覆蓋原文件中的內容;如果文件不存在,就創建文件;如果文件存在,就將其清空;一般我們備份清理日志文件的時候

兩個>即>>表示:追加到原文件中的內容之后;果文件不存在,就創建文件;如果文件存在,則將新的內容追加到那個文件的末尾,該文件中的原有內容不受影響

2、Linux輸出重定向
輸出重定向:改變程序運行的輸入來源和輸出地點。

主要的適用方法如下表所示:

 

輸出重定向
類型 符號 功能
標準輸出重定向 命令 >文件 以覆蓋方式,把命令的正確輸出內容輸出到指定的文件或設備當中
命令 >>文件 以追加方式,把命令的正確輸出內容輸出到指定的文件或設備當中
標準錯誤輸出重定向 錯誤命令 2>文件 以覆蓋方式,把命令的錯誤輸出內容輸出到指定的文件或設備當中
錯誤命令 2>>文件 以追加方式,把命令的錯誤輸出內容輸出到指定的文件或設備當中
正確/錯誤輸出同時保存 命令 > 文件 2>&1 以覆蓋方式,把命令的正確輸出和錯誤輸出內容保存到同一個文件當中
命令 >> 文件 2>&1 以追加方式,把命令的正確輸出和錯誤輸出內容保存到同一個文件當中
命令 &> 文件 以覆蓋方式,把命令的正確輸出和錯誤輸出內容保存到同一個文件當中
命令 &>> 文件 以追加方式,把命令的正確輸出和錯誤輸出內容保存到同一個文件當中
命令 >>文件1 2>文件2 以追加方式,把命令的正確輸出保存在文件1中;以覆蓋方式,把命令的錯誤輸出內容保存到文件2中

 

3、Linux輸入重定向

 

輸入重定向
類型 符號 功能
標準輸入 命令 <文件1 命令把文件1的內容作為標準輸入
標識符限定輸入 命令 <<標識符 命令從標準輸入中讀入內容,直到遇到“標識符”分界符位置
輸入輸出重定向 命令 <文件1 >文件2 命令把文件1的內容作為標準輸入,把文件2作為標準輸出

 

總結一五Linux的輸入輸出重定向:

1、重新設置命令的默認輸入,輸出,指向到自己文件(文件,文件描述符,設備其實都是文件,因為linux就是基于設備也是文件,描述符也指向是文件)

2、擴展自己新的描述符,對文件進行讀寫操作

延伸 · 閱讀

精彩推薦
  • Linux在Linux系統上安裝配置DNS服務器的教程

    在Linux系統上安裝配置DNS服務器的教程

    這篇文章主要介紹了在Linux上安裝配置DNS服務器的教程,文中示例基于CentOS系統,需要的朋友可以參考下...

    51CTO6832019-07-03
  • LinuxLinux 將支持基于 Li-Fi 的新型網絡技術

    Linux 將支持基于 Li-Fi 的新型網絡技術

    據 phoronix 報道,Li-Fi 技術供應商 PureLiFi 近來正在向 Linux 內核社區積極貢獻代碼,以推動將其開源的 Li-Fi 驅動程序并入 Linux 內核主線。...

    開源中國4602020-12-09
  • Linuxlinux下時間同步的兩種方法分享

    linux下時間同步的兩種方法分享

    在需要集中記錄服務器日志的環境中,時間同步那是相當的重要的。本文為大家介紹兩種同步linux時間的方法,供大家參考 ...

    Linux教程網6312019-12-10
  • LinuxLinux下查看使用的是哪種shell的方法匯總

    Linux下查看使用的是哪種shell的方法匯總

    這篇文章主要介紹了Linux下查看使用的是哪種shell的方法匯總,本文總結了9種查看當前系統使用的是哪種shell的方法,需要的朋友可以參考下 ...

    Linux技術網9282019-10-25
  • Linuxlinux下gettimeofday函數windows替換方法(詳解)

    linux下gettimeofday函數windows替換方法(詳解)

    下面小編就為大家帶來一篇linux下gettimeofday函數windows替換方法(詳解)。小編覺得挺不錯的,現在就分享給大家,也給大家做個參考。一起跟隨小編過來看看...

    Linux教程網7612021-12-15
  • LinuxLinux基礎:如何找出你的系統所支持的最大內存

    Linux基礎:如何找出你的系統所支持的最大內存

    這篇文章主要介紹了Linux基礎:如何找出你的系統所支持的最大內存,需要的朋友可以參考下...

    Linux教程網12962021-10-25
  • Linux致命的7個Linux命令

    致命的7個Linux命令

    如果你是一個 Linux 新手,在好奇心的驅使下,可能會去嘗試從各個渠道獲得的命令。以下是 7 個致命的 Linux 命令,輕則使你的數據造成丟失,重則使你的...

    Linux教程網10082021-10-08
  • LinuxLinux命令學習總結:詳解reboot命令

    Linux命令學習總結:詳解reboot命令

    這篇文章主要介紹了Linux命令學習總結:詳解reboot命令,這個指令使用起來非常簡單,有興趣的可以了解一下。...

    瀟湘隱者9262021-12-03
主站蜘蛛池模板: 亚洲一区二区三区日本久久九 | 国产一区视频在线观看免费 | 国产一区二区不卡 | 久草在线精品观看 | 日本在线视频二区 | 88xx成人永久免费观看 | 91高清国产视频 | av电影在线免费观看 | 中文字幕在线一 | 欧美交在线 | 999久久国产 | 久久久久久久久成人 | 少妇一级淫片高潮流水电影 | 欧美日韩亚洲成人 | 伊人网站| 欧美特级一级毛片 | 久草资源在线观看 | 爱福利视频网 | 斗罗破苍穹在线观看免费完整观看 | 亚洲爱爱网站 | 亚a在线 | 欧美日韩高清一区二区三区 | 免费国产不卡午夜福在线 | 亚洲欧美国产高清va在线播放 | 国产一区成人 | 91热久久免费频精品黑人99 | 在线播放亚洲视频 | 日韩aⅴ一区二区三区 | 激情免费视频 | 在线视频欧美一区 | 欧美一级理论 | 天天舔天天插 | 欧洲性xxxxx 亚洲第一精品在线 | 日韩欧美动作影片 | 中文字幕国 | 操操日日| 天堂精品 | 日韩在线视频导航 | 免费国产人成网站 | 91网页在线观看 | 国产亚洲小视频 |